MMON进程介绍
MMON进程是数据库10g版本引入的进程,是数据库的很多自我监视和自我调整
功能的支持进程。
此数据库实例收集有关活动和性能的大量统计数据。这些统计数据收集到SGA中,
通过发出sql查询,可以询问他们的当前值。
MMON从SGA定期捕获统计数据(默认是每小时一次),并将它们写入到数据字典中,在数据字典中,可以无限期的存储它们(不过,默认方式是只存储8天)。
每当MMON收集一组统计数据(称为快照)时,它还启动ADDM。ADDM工具使用由多名
DBA历经多年开发的专家系统来分析数据库活动。它观察两个快照(默认是当前快照和先前的快照),并得出有关性能的观察结果和建议。
除了收集快照外,MMON还持续监视数据库和实例,来确定是否应该发出任何警报。

手动发起快照并使用10046进行跟踪,尝试几次有出现快照未生成当前session就被kill的现象
文档 2043531.1 有介绍
Taking an AWR snapshot executes many SQL statements to generate a new snapshot and has a built-in timeout mechanism, which causes timeouts between 300 and 900 seconds by default. As a result, if snapshot generation stalls, "Time limit violation" or "Runtime exceeded" messages and associated ORA-12751 errors are raised.
获取AWR快照将执行许多SQL语句来生成新的快照,并具有内置超时机制,该机制在默认情况下会导致300到900秒的超时。因此,如果快照生成停止,就会引发“时间限制违规”或“运行时超限”消息和相关的ORA-12751错误。

可以看到这三个表无统计信息,特别是X$KEWSSVCV的NUM_ROWS与实际行数有显著差异。
因此,优化器在X$KEWSSMAP、X$KEWSSVCV和X$KSWSASTAB之间选择了不合适的连接顺序,并选择了无效索引来访问X$KEWSSVCV。

实例1服务中出现大量的unknown
在数据泵处理过程中,“——UNKNOWN——”服务名称将随着创建/删除服务的增加而增加,话单系统每月会调用大量的expdp进行表级备份任务发给nbu处理,吊起进程皆在节点1发起,所以导致节点1有这么多的UNKNOWN

##X$KEWSSVCV是内存表也是gv$service_stats的基表,生成snapshot的时候慢的那条insert into WRH$_SERVICE_STAT 也使用到了这个表且耗时巨长

收集相关表统计信息
SQL> EXEC DBMS_STATS.GATHER_TABLE_STATS('SYS', 'X$KSWSASTAB', no_invalidate=>false);

PL/SQL procedure successfully completed.

SQL> EXEC DBMS_STATS.GATHER_TABLE_STATS('SYS', 'X$KEWSSMAP', no_invalidate=>false);

PL/SQL procedure successfully completed.

SQL> EXEC DBMS_STATS.GATHER_TABLE_STATS('SYS', 'X$KEWSSVCV', no_invalidate=>false);

PL/SQL procedure successfully completed.

检查mmon挂起状态
SQL> oradebug unit_test kebm_dmp_slv_attrs kewrmafsa_
Status: 3
Flags: 0
Runtime limit: 900
CPU time limit: 300
Violations: 28
Suspended until: 1589036765 <<<<<不为0代表挂起


再次实验AWR可以手动生成,观察后续
SQL> EXECUTE DBMS_WORKLOAD_REPOSITORY.CREATE_SNAPSHOT();

PL/SQL procedure successfully completed.

SQL>

SQL> oradebug unit_test kebm_dmp_slv_attrs kewrmafsa_
Status: 3
Flags: 0
Runtime limit: 900
CPU time limit: 300
Violations: 28
Suspended until: 1589036765
SQL>

并在必要时执行以下命令以解除MMON挂起状态。

SQL> oradebug unit_test kebm_set_slv_attrs kewrmafsa_ retain retain retain retain 0 0
Modified attributes of kewrmafsa_ (slave id 13)
SQL>
SQL> oradebug unit_test kebm_dmp_slv_attrs kewrmafsa_
Status: 3
Flags: 0
Runtime limit: 900
CPU time limit: 300
Violations: 0
Suspended until: 0
SQL>

总结:因为频繁的datapump备份导致X$KEWSSVCV基表更新频繁,且X$KEWSSVCV表无统计信息(统计信息自动收集已经关闭),导致创建snapshot语句执行计划不对耗时长被自动kill
X$KEWSSVCV表是内存表一般需要重启实例释放
所以,收集这几个表的统计信息,让创建snapshot语句根据CBO自动走正确的执行计划即可
